How To Fight Vehicular Rust

Posted on

A very big problem that people have with vehicles is rust. Rust is one of the worst things that can happen to the body of your car. The metal that the car is made of will oxidize and will become weak and eventually corrode into dust if it is not taken care of as soon as possible. The good news is that you can do a lot to prevent and treat the rust before it starts to corrode the metal you car is made from.…

How To Properly Re-Spool A Cable On A Newly-Installed Truck Winch

Posted on

Truck winches are designed to operate reliably and safely, but unless their cables are properly spooled, winches can jam or even fail dangerously. When purchasing a winch for your truck, the first step after installation is to re-spool the cable to ensure it is ready for use. Below is how to do it safely and securely: 1. Prepare to work safely - When operating your winch, you must make the proper safety preparations to prevent serious injury or even death.…
